Have had a lot of views on this and my previous ad, but no interest as yet. Is the price wrong?


It's a combination of things. Firstly it's an awful time to sell at the moment as nobody has any money on the run up to christmas. Secondly getting over £2.5k for any 80's/90's mini is a challenge with the market as it is. Thirdly the debumpered racer look wont appeal to everyone, so as nice as your car is, you may have to wait a while for the right type of buyer to come along. Finally and probably most importantly, selling a car with a very short MOT puts a lot of buyers off. An MOT only costs £40-£50 and takes an hour to do, so if a car is roadworthy and will go through an MOT, then it makes sense to put a full MOT on any car you are trying to sell. Buyers know this and therefore will often assume that the only reason a seller wouldn't put a full MOT on a car before selling is, because they know that the car would fail an MOT.

So putting all that together, I'd wait until spring then put a full MOT on it and advertise it on somewhere like pistonheads, where the type of buyer you want for this car is likely too look. Personally I'd advertise it at £2,6995 with a view to getting £2.5k for it. Failing that, to sell a car with one months MOT at this time of year, I think you'll have to drop the asking price considerably.
